Arctic Trail Blazers Make History (via BBC News)
Two German ships have become the first Western commercial vessels to navigate the Northeast Passage - a shipping route which goes from Asia to Europe around the Russian Arctic…
In the past, no foreign ships were allowed to cross the Northeast Passage. But now Russia’s security concerns have given way to the desire for a slice of the fat pie which is the international shipping business…
Going via the Russian Arctic cuts the distance from, say, South Korea to the Netherlands by up to 75%. This means the time in transit can be cut by as much as 10 days….
